New chairman takes helm as Grand Duchy buys out Qatar Cargolux stake

CARGOLUX Airlines International, Europe's largest all-cargo airline and launch customer for the new generation Boeing 747-8 freighter, has announced changes to its board of directors following the acquisition by the Luxembourg state of a 35 per cent stake in the airline from Qatar Airways on 31 December.

Paul Helminger has been elected chairman, with Alphonse Berns, Paul Mousel and Patrick Nickels appointed directors of a company, which employs 1,500 people and offers a global trucking network to more than 250 destinations as well as charter and aircraft maintenance services.

 

The cargo carrier's ownership structure is now Luxair 43.4 per cent, the Grand Duchy of Luxembourg, 35 per cent; Banque et Caisse d'Epargne de l'Etat (BCEE), 10.9 per cent and Societe Nationale de Credit et d'Investissement (SNCI), 10.7 per cent.

 

Its fleet comprises six B747-8 freighters and eleven B747-400 freighters and covers a network of 90 destinations, 60 of which are served on scheduled all-cargo flights.
